Let us understand the difference between MySQL Standard and Enterprise servers: MySQL Standard Server ACID refers to Atomicity, Consistency, Isolation, and Durability. This makes it a fully integrated software, which is transaction safe, and ACID compliant database. The standard edition comes with InnoDB, which is the engine used while working with databases. It is easy to use, since it is reliable and gives industrial strength performance. MySQL standard edition ensures that user delivers high-performance and provides scalability on OLTP applications (Online Transaction Processing). It is completely developed, managed and supported by the MySQL Team. MySQL Database Service is a fully managed database service that helps deploy cloud-native applications using the MySQL, which is considered as the world’s most popular open source database. It reduces the risk, complication, and cost associated with development, deployment, and management of business-critical MySQL applications. MySQL Enterprise Edition comes with advanced features, management tools, and technical support that helps users achieve the highest levels of MySQL scalability, security, reliability, and uptime.
